Можно ли как-то сгенерировать случайный идентификатор пользователя Woocommerce? - PullRequest
0 голосов
/ 01 февраля 2020

Дело в том, что мы хотим генерировать случайный идентификатор пользователя при каждой регистрации пользователя, поскольку мы предоставляем услугу и нам нужно выдать случайный идентификатор пользователя каждому из них. Будет лучше, если идентификатор пользователя содержит 3 буквы и 5 цифр. Идентификатор пользователя также должен отображаться на панели пользователя. Стек: WP + Woo Есть идеи? Спасибо.

Ответы [ 2 ]

0 голосов
/ 28 апреля 2020

Вы можете использовать этот плагин: https://wordpress.org/plugins/random-user-ids/

Предупреждение: этот плагин предназначен для установки сразу после установки WordPress, так как он также меняет идентификатор для первого пользователя-администратора.

Благодаря дизайну WordPress идентификаторы пользователей должны быть целыми числами.

0 голосов
/ 01 февраля 2020

WordPress уже создает уникальный идентификатор пользователя с каждым новым регистром. Вам необходимо добавить пользовательское метаполе с извлечением из woocommerce.

Пример руководства из точки быстрого поиска в Google к следующему

https://iconicwp.com/blog/the-ultimate-guide-to-adding-custom-woocommerce-user-account-fields/

Как сохранить пользовательские мета-поля WooCommerce Checkout для пользователя meta - Скрытое поле может быть добавлено со случайной строкой

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...